Understanding Licensing and Regulation in Canada

When searching for a top-tier online casino, the first and foremost consideration should be its licensing and regulatory compliance. While online gambling is technically a grey area federally in Canada, provincial governments have the authority to regulate it within their borders. This means a casino licensed by a reputable provincial authority, such as the Kahnawake Gaming Commission, the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O), or the British Columbia Lottery Corporation (BCLC), is generally considered a safe and legitimate option. These bodies impose strict standards on operators, ensuring fair gaming practices, player protection, and responsible gambling measures. It's important to verify that a casino holds a valid license from a recognized jurisdiction. A legitimate license demonstrates a commitment to transparency and accountability.

The Role of Independent Auditors

Beyond licensing, reputable online casinos undergo regular audits by independent testing agencies such as e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) and iTech Labs. These audits verify the fairness of the casino’s games, particularly the Random Number Generators (RNGs) that determine the outcomes of games like slots, blackjack, and roulette. An RNG audit confirms that the games are genuinely random and not rigged in favor of the house. Look for casinos that prominently display seals of approval from these independent auditors, as this offers an additional layer of assurance. The absence of such seals should raise a red flag and prompt further investigation before depositing any funds.

Payment Options and Banking Security

Seamless and secure banking is essential for a positive online casino experience. The best casinos offer a variety of payment methods, including credit and debit cards (Visa, Mastercard), e-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ies (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in). The availability of multiple convenient and reliable payment options caters to different player preferences and ensures easy deposit and withdrawal processes. Crucially, a reputable casino will employ robust security measures, such as SSL encryption, to protect your financial information during transactions. Look for casinos that clearly outline their banking policies and fees.

Responsible Gambling Features

A commitment to responsible gambling is a hallmark of a reputable online casino. Operators should offer t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These features may include deposit limits, wagering lim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support organizations like Gamblers Anonymous. A responsible casino actively promotes safe gambling practices and prioritizes the well-being of its players.
